Removed Skins: Why Are They Gone?
Blizzard, the developer of Overwatch, has removed certain skins due to various reasons such as controversies, exclusivity, or limited availability. One example is the Pink Mercy skin, which was sold for a limited time during the breast cancer awareness charity event in 2018. Since then, this skin is no longer available for purchase.

All About Merging and Account Linking
Do You Know How To Link Your Account? With the introduction of Overwatch 2, Blizzard implemented a cross-progression system allowing players to link their console account with their Battle.net account. However, there may be a problem when merging accounts: if the accounts have differences in data, server errors may occur, causing merging difficulties. Additionally, you might experience account linking issues with console games.
To overcome this challenge, it’s crucial to ensure a solid network connection and make sure that the game files are updated correctly.
